Steven Seelig is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Steven Seelig has authored 67 papers receiving a total of 3.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Molecular Biology, 19 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and 16 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Steven Seelig’s work include Growth Hormone and Insulin-like Growth Factors (13 papers),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(8 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(7 papers). Steven Seelig is often cited by papers focused on Growth Hormone and Insulin-like Growth Factors (13 papers),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(8 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(7 papers). Steven Seelig collaborates with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and United Kingdom. Steven Seelig's co-authors include George Sayers, Jack H. Oppenheimer, Susan A. Berry, Cary N. Mariash and Howard C. Towle and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
